Hall of Fame

Bill McKalip
- Induction:
- 1990
Known as "Wild Bill" McKalip, he played at Oregon State from 1926-28. As a senior he earned All-Pacific Coast Conference First Team, Associated Press All-Northwest First Team, and United Press International All-Coast Second Team. At the conclusion of his college career, he played in the 1930 East-West Shrine Game.
He later was a three-time All-Pro selection with Portsmouth and Detroit.
McKalip was a 1991 inductee into the State of Oregon Sports Hall of Fame.
